Cubic Feet to Cubic Yards Formula
One cubic yard contains 27 cubic feet, so the conversion is a single division or multiplication depending on which way you are going.
yd^3 = ft^3 / 27
To go the other way, multiply instead of divide:
ft^3 = yd^3 * 27
When you start from measurements rather than a finished volume, find the cubic feet first, then divide by 27:
yd^3 = (length_ft * width_ft * height_ft) / 27
- yd^3 is the volume in cubic yards.
- ft^3 is the volume in cubic feet.
- length_ft, width_ft, height_ft are the three dimensions of the space, each measured in feet.
- 27 is the number of cubic feet in one cubic yard, because a cubic yard is 3 feet on every side and 3 x 3 x 3 = 27.

Cubic Feet to Cubic Yards Conversion Reference
Common cubic feet amounts and their cubic yard equivalents:
| Cubic feet (ft³) | Cubic yards (yd³) |
|---|---|
| 1 | 0.037 |
| 10 | 0.370 |
| 27 | 1.000 |
| 50 | 1.852 |
| 100 | 3.704 |
| 135 | 5.000 |
| 500 | 18.519 |
| 1000 | 37.037 |
To convert a measurement that is not in feet, change it to feet before multiplying:
| Length unit | Multiply by to get feet |
|---|---|
| Inches | 0.08333 (divide by 12) |
| Yards | 3 |
| Meters | 3.28084 |
| Centimeters | 0.03281 |
Example Problems
Example 1. You have 135 cubic feet of mulch. Divide by 27 to get cubic yards: 135 / 27 = 5 cubic yards.
Example 2. A garden bed is 12 feet long, 9 feet wide, and filled 4 inches deep. First convert the depth to feet: 4 / 12 = 0.333 feet. The cubic feet are 12 * 9 * 0.333 = 36 cubic feet. Divide by 27 to get 36 / 27 = 1.333 cubic yards.
Frequently Asked Questions
How many cubic feet are in a cubic yard?
There are 27 cubic feet in one cubic yard. A cubic yard measures 3 feet by 3 feet by 3 feet, and 3 times 3 times 3 equals 27.
How do you convert cubic feet to cubic yards?
Divide the number of cubic feet by 27. For example, 81 cubic feet divided by 27 equals 3 cubic yards. To reverse it, multiply the cubic yards by 27.
Why do materials like soil, gravel and concrete get sold by the cubic yard?
Bulk materials are heavy and are moved in large quantities, so the cubic yard is a more practical unit than the cubic foot. Converting your project volume to cubic yards lets you order the right amount and compare prices, which are usually quoted per cubic yard.
